What types of risk should you be aware of when managing treasury risk? What strategies can you use to gain a more favorable return or market position? Treasury risk management is an important and vital aspect of any organization, and success is often dependent on an organization’s ability to forecast, navigate, and address financial risk. By understanding more about the financial risks and rewards involved with managing treasury risk, organizations can make informed decisions and implement effective strategies to optimize their financial positions.
In this course on Treasury Risk Management, you will learn about the different financial risks associated with treasury management. We will discuss financial strategies you can use to manage your treasury more effectively. You will learn how to use derivatives, forwards, futures, swaps, and options to mitigate potential risks and optimize your financial positions. By the end of the course, you will have the skills you need to confidently navigate the complexities of treasury risk management.
You will learn about the different financial risks associated with treasury management, financial strategies to manage treasury more effectively, and how to use derivatives, forwards, futures, swaps, and options to mitigate risks and optimize financial positions.
The course covers risk management, managing a company's risk, interest rate risk (including bonds), foreign exchange risk (including transaction and translation risks), commodity price risk, hedging, active hedging, speculation, arbitrage, and derivatives such as forwards, futures, swaps, and options.
